About dhur and square inch

Dhur: A dhur is a small land unit used mainly in Bihar and eastern Uttar Pradesh, where 1 katha = 20 dhur and 1 dhur = 20 dhurki.

Square Inch: A square inch is a 1 in × 1 in square — 6.4516 cm².

Why does the dhur vary by state?
The dhur is a traditional unit recorded differently in each state's revenue system, and many states use a larger "pucca" and a smaller "kachha" version. There is no single national value, so the only correct conversion is the one for your specific state or district.
